App Discovery: How ASO, SEO & GEO Converged in 2026

by | Jul 12, 2026 | AI, ASO

For ten years, the playbook for getting an app discovered was simple to draw, even if it was hard to execute: pick your keywords, win store search, defend your rank, pour paid UA on top.

However, discovery now forms somewhere else: someone sees a clip on TikTok, asks a friend, reads a Reddit thread, types “best app to fix my sleep” into ChatGPT, then searches your name in the store. By the time they reach your product page, the decision is mostly made. Your App Store page is the bottom of the funnel.

This is the new reality of app discovery: ASO (App Store Optimization), SEO, and GEO (Generative Engine Optimization) are three surfaces of one job.

Below, we’re looking into them, and see where app discovery now happens and what changed on each:

  • The store, where search went semantic and the App Store quietly moved onto the open web.
  • The web, where the cost of publishing hit zero and volume stopped signaling anything.
  • AI answers, a new shelf that’s mostly empty.

Three surfaces, one shift

1. Inside the store, search went semantic, while the store left the store

Two things happened at once, and most teams only noticed the first.

First: Apple’s search algorithm shifted from exact-keyword matching toward semantic, intent-based matching. Stuffing your subtitle and keyword field still works, but it’s the most competitive it’s ever been. Apple states that search results may include app tags, “generated using large language models (LLMs) based on the metadata you’ve provided in App Store Connect”. There is now a model sitting between your metadata and what the store decides your app is.

Second, and bigger: the App Store is on the web now. Product pages, editorial stories, in-app events, charts… all live, structured, crawlable URLs. Which means your product page is no longer only a store asset. It’s a web page competing in Google, and a document an AI assistant can read and cite when someone asks which app to use. You are ranking on the open web whether you meant to or not.

That quietly rewrites the metadata rulebook. Your long description, for a decade the field ASO people wrote for conversion and nobody optimized for ranking, is now the richest block of text a crawler or a model has to understand what your app actually does.

Same fields for two audiences, with two sets of rules, running simultaneously, and almost nobody is writing for both.

2. On the web, the bar is rising

The cost of producing a competent-looking blog post has gone to roughly zero. Anyone can ship and everyone is, which means the old “More posts, more keywords, more rankings” is over. It worked when publishing was expensive and volume was itself a costly signal of effort. But it isn’t anymore, so it signals nothing.

When supply of adequate content is infinite, the only currencies left are the ones a model can’t manufacture: original data, a named human with credentials behind the claim, a genuine point of view, something that earns a citation instead of assembling one.

The machinery underneath rewards exactly that. We know this less from Google than from a courtroom: the DOJ antitrust trial (2023–2024) surfaced internal systems like QBST (Query-Based Salient Terms). It’s a “memorization system” that learns which terms a relevant page should contain for a given query. Search “best running shoes” and it expects “cushioning” “stability” “mileage”. Stuffing the exact phrase ten times over doesn’t move it anymore. This algorithm matches that vocabulary against your page; its sibling Navboost weighs the same against real click data.

The headline for app teams: a blog is now an entity-authority engine, and it has rules most apps ignore. They start below the content: even a post that earns a citation never gets one if the page it sits on is unreadable to a crawler. Most of those rules are about engineering and technical SEO, which is exactly why product teams skip them. The SEO basics live in the code (and you can run free audits with the demo of Screaming Frog): a unique, intent-led title tag and a single clear H1 per page; a real heading hierarchy (H1 > H2 > H3) that maps the structure of the content; images and video that are compressed, lazy-loaded, and carry actual alt text and transcripts; and a Search Console property that’s connected, so you measure what you rank for. The classic own-goal is keyword cannibalization: 3 thin pages all chasing “calorie tracker” split the signal so none of them ranks, whereas one strong page would win (we suggest you use Semrush Cannibalization Report tool to discover them). Unglamorous, mostly invisible in a demo, but those trace the line between a page a model can read and one it skips.

3. In AI answers, a whole new shelf exists and it’s mostly empty

When someone asks ChatGPT or Perplexity for “the best app for X”, your app is either in that answer or it isn’t. The signals that earn you a mention are your presence on the sources AI actually cites:

  • Community platforms like Reddit and Quora are essentials here.
  • Freshness also matters, and recently updated content gets cited at multiples of stale content.
  • You have to be a recognized entity, consistently described across the web, before a model will confidently recommend you.

The base layer is a Wikidata entry: the open, structured knowledge base that both trains the models and feeds Google’s Knowledge Graph. So a clean, consistent entry is you describing yourself to the machines in their own format. On top of that, a Knowledge Graph entity Google actually resolves your brand to. Leave them blank and every model is guessing who you are from scattered third-party mentions.

To clarify, every AI answer engine reaches your site through a named crawler: GPTBot, ClaudeBot, PerplexityBot, Applebot… If your robots.txt disallows them, you are absent from them, by your own instruction. Most of the robots.txt files we find on app sites are copy-pasted defensive templates from an industry with the opposite business model, like publisher sites.

The stack, by surface

The store (ASO): Your existing stack still holds. What changes is what you’re writing for: the keyword field feeds a semantic layer now, and your long description feeds the open web.

The web (SEO): Search Console, Screaming Frog for crawl and indexation, Semrush

The crawl layer: Before anything else, check if crawlers can reach you with LLM Pulse’s robots.txt checker and tells you which of GPTBot, ClaudeBot, PerplexityBot and Google-Extended your own file is blocking.

AI answers (GEO):

LLM Pulse is domain-first, tracks share of voice and citations across ChatGPT, Perplexity, Gemini and AI Overviews, and it now also tracks App Store and Play links specifically, which is the signal that matters most.

AppTweak’s AI Visibility for Apps is app-first and starts from the intents in your app category and measures whether AI assistants recommend your app, by name.

The surface marketing can’t fix

Discovery no longer stops at the store: Siri, Spotlight, and Apple Intelligence can surface an app’s actions. “Log my run”, “Start a 20-minute focus session”. The mechanism is App Intents, the framework that declares to the system what your app can do, in a form Apple’s models can read.

We’re not covering App Intents here; it’s real engineering scope and deserves its own piece. We’re flagging it because of who owns it as it lives in the codebase.

Discovery has quietly become a product problem too.

The connective insight: all three surfaces now reward one clear story about who you’re for and what you solve, expressed in language that machines interpreting intent can understand.

FAQ: ASO, SEO & GEO for app teams

What is GEO for apps?

Generative Engine Optimization for apps is the practice of getting your app named and recommended inside AI-generated answers such as ChatGPT, Perplexity, Google AI Overviews, rather than only ranking in App Store search. Unlike ASO, which optimizes store metadata, GEO optimizes the web content and entity signals a model reads before it decides which apps to recommend.

Does the App Store affect SEO?

Yes, and it now works both ways. App Store product pages, editorial stories and in-app events are live, crawlable URLs on the open web. Your product page can rank in Google and be cited by an AI assistant, which means your long description, historically written only for conversion, is now the richest text a crawler has to understand your app.

How do I get my app recommended by ChatGPT?

3 requirements:

  • Be crawlable (check your robots.txt for GPTBot, ClaudeBot, PerplexityBot, Applebot).
  • Be a recognizable entity (Wikidata entry, consistent description across the web).
  • Be present on the sources AI actually cites, which in app categories means Reddit, comparison content, and recent, credible reviews.

Is ASO still worth it in 2026?

Yes. Store search still converts intent better than any other surface. But now, the decision is often made before a user ever opens the App Store.
